Pomerene Foundation Fall Trail Run Half Marathon

I'm in a bizarre gap between fall races.  Last week was this half marathon in Millersburg and my next race won't be for a while.  Odd for the fall. 

This race was well organized but I just wasn't feeling it.  We had some hot and humid weather in the week leading up to this one.  It cooled down a bit on race morning, but not enough to make much of a difference.  The course was not quite what I was expecting.  I knew it would be on the bike path, but I was really expecting some hills considering all of Holmes County is hilly.  It wasn't.  It was pancake flat as the path runs next to a river.  I don't do the best on flat courses, though I was ok with my performance in this one.

We started out on a bizarre half mile run before turning right around and heading the opposite way.  Odd.  I'm not sure why they didn't just add a half mile to the turnaround point.  Anyway, I started out a bit quicker than I needed to with the first three miles coming in around 8 minutes each.  There weren't many people around for the majority of the race so I just acted like it was a training run.  There were some nice sections of the path, but the majority of it really reminded me of the Little Miami Half Marathon I ran back in 2011.  It was just kind of dull. 

I slowed down considerably after the turnaround point.  I was around 7 miles at the one hour mark, so I knew I was safely going to come in under two hours.  I mostly just tried to zone out, listen to music and stay hydrated.  Meh.  Not much more I can say. 

The finish was not my usual strong effort, but I was able to come in under the 1:50 mark at 1:49:51.  That was good enough for second in my age group, though again this was a very small race.
